Preparing Future Developers for New Challenges: Meeting the Demands of Emerging Brands in the Web3 Era
As the digital landscape continues to evolve, developers are faced with an ever-growing array of challenges, many of which are fueled by the rapid pace of technological advancement.
In this new era, Web3, or the decentralized web, has emerged as a key factor that is transforming the way developers approach their work. To remain competitive and relevant in the face of new demands from emerging brands, developers must stay up-to-date with the latest developments and be prepared to adapt to the changing landscape. This article will explore the key challenges faced by future developers, focusing on the Web3 transition, and provide insights into how developers can be prepared to meet the demands of new brands.
Embracing Decentralization
Web3 is centered around the concept of decentralization, which promotes the distribution of resources, decision-making, and control over networks. This shift requires developers to reevaluate their current methods and embrace new technologies such as blockchain, distributed ledgers, and smart contracts. By staying informed on these technologies and incorporating them into their skillset, developers can position themselves to address the unique requirements of new brands seeking to leverage the benefits of decentralization.
Understanding Tokenomics and Digital Assets
With the increasing popularity of cryptocurrencies and digital assets, developers must become familiar with tokenomics, the study of the economics surrounding tokens and their ecosystems. This knowledge will be essential for building applications and platforms that integrate digital assets, enabling developers to create solutions that meet the needs of brands operating in the crypto space.
Ensuring Data Privacy and Security
Data privacy and security have become paramount concerns for individuals and businesses alike. As new brands emerge and the digital landscape evolves, developers must prioritize building secure applications and platforms that protect user data. This includes staying informed on the latest security protocols, encryption techniques, and privacy-focused technologies, such as zero-knowledge proofs.
Adopting Interoperability
The Web3 era is characterized by the need for seamless collaboration and communication across different platforms and protocols. Developers must prioritize interoperability when building applications, ensuring that their solutions can easily integrate with other systems, platforms, and networks. This can be achieved by staying up-to-date on emerging standards and protocols, as well as developing a deep understanding of how different technologies interact with one another.
Nurturing Soft Skills
As the digital landscape becomes more complex, it's crucial for developers to cultivate strong communication, problem-solving, and collaboration skills. This will not only enable them to work effectively in cross-functional teams but also allow them to better understand and address the unique needs of emerging brands.
The rapidly evolving digital landscape, driven by the Web3 transition, presents a host of new challenges for future developers. By staying informed on the latest developments, embracing decentralization, understanding tokenomics, prioritizing data privacy and security, adopting interoperability, and nurturing soft skills, developers can be well-prepared to meet the demands of new brands and remain competitive in the ever-changing world of technology.